Basket vase

Made at: Plateelbakkerrij Zuid-Holland
Marked by: Adrianus Lansaat (Dutch, active 1898–1907; 1912–1915)
Dutch (Gouda)
about 1915

Medium/Technique Glazed buff earthenware
Dimensions Overall: 24.1 x 24.1 cm (9 1/2 x 9 1/2 in.)
Credit Line Gift of Jacob A. Azar
Accession Number2004.2246
NOT ON VIEW
CollectionsEurope
ClassificationsCeramicsPotteryEarthenware

DescriptionA basket-form vase with large, arching handle, decorated with Art Nouveau-inspired floral decoration in gold, magenta, purple, green and blue, and with a photographically transferred portrait based on a 17th-century Dutch souce [Frans Hals, Portrait of Pieter Tjarck, Los Angeles County Museum of Art?] within a shaped reserve on the front.
Marks Painted in brown enamel on underside of base: factory mark (a small house) with "MADE IN/ HOLLAND". Painter's mark "A. L." painted above.
InscriptionsModel number incised below factory mark, on underside of base: "171/ W."
Provenance1998, Daryle Lambert, Glencoe, IL; 1998, sold by Lambert to Jacob Azar, Charlestown, MA; 2004, gift of Jacob Azar to the MFA. (Accession Date: January 26, 2005)
